Once again, people, rail shooters are not inherently "lesser" than more traditional FPSes. Umbrella Chronicles was quite a fun game, Sin & Punishment was amazing, the Star Fox series when Nintendo still knew what they were doing with it... even Pokemon Snap qualifies, in a less violent way. Rail shooters are a legitimate genre that give the developers more control over how they present the story to the gamer. For Dead Space, consideration over the storytelling is a very good thing.

Also, I get the feeling you're disagreeing simply to disagree with me, now. Arcade games do not, all-inclusively, "blow." If it weren't for arcade games and their comparatively impressive (for the time of manufacture) hardware, consoles would not have been pushed to look better. Arcade games also were constant innovators, as single-game cabinets gave the developers freedom to create brand-new, interesting methods of control particular to the game. Arcade games are an important part of gaming history (Pac-Man and Donkey Kong, anyone?), and continue to be a huge staple in gaming, if not in North America.
